Weather in Byron Bay in January
Australia · 20-year averages, January
A good month. January is a solid month to be in Byron Bay. Highs average 26.3 °C, lows 24 °C, and rain falls on 14 days — nothing in the month is working against you.
January ranks 9 of 12 in Byron Bay: past the worst of the year but short of August, which is the month to book if the dates are open.
Rain on 14 days, 4 of them heavy. Enough to need a plan B, not enough to need a plan around it. Nothing specialised needed — this is the month you pack for the trip rather than for the weather.
What the averages hide
Averages flatten a month, and this one hides a few things: it never really gets hot: not one day in an average January reaches 30 °C; the day barely swings — 2.2 °C between the overnight low and the afternoon high. Across the twenty years measured, the hottest January day reached 31.3 °C and the coldest night fell to 21.6 °C, and the wettest single day dropped 157 mm — roughly 98% of the month's rain in one day.
January is moderately variable: 7 mm in the driest year against 382 mm in the wettest, around an average of 160 mm. Roughly two Januarys in three land near that average, and the third does something else entirely.
Wind sits around 20.1 km/h — a steady breeze rather than a nuisance, and welcome on the warmer days, and humidity runs at 77%, high enough to notice on the warm days without dominating them.
How January sits in the year
Temperatures hold steady either side: 25.5 °C in December, 26.3 here, 26.3 in February. Nothing about the timing within the month matters much.
Daylight in January
January is at or near the longest days of Byron Bay's year: 13.8 hours of daylight, losing 0.5 hours across the month. Evenings are the real gain — dinner outdoors still happens in full light.
Sea temperature
The sea sits at about 26.2 °C in January — warm enough to stay in as long as you like. This is the warmest the water gets all year.

Every month in Byron Bay
| Month | High °C | Low °C | Rain days | Rain mm | Humidity % | Daylight h | Sea °C | Score |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 26.3 | 24 | 14 | 160 | 77 | 13.8 | 26.2 | 72 |
| February | 26.3 | 24.2 | 15 | 169 | 77 | 13.1 | 26.5 | 69 |
| March | 25.6 | 23.5 | 19 | 168 | 77 | 12.3 | 26.1 | 65 |
| April | 24.1 | 21.9 | 14 | 96 | 74 | 11.4 | 25.3 | 73 |
| May | 22.1 | 19.5 | 11 | 78 | 71 | 10.7 | 24.2 | 80 |
| June | 20.4 | 17.7 | 12 | 108 | 72 | 10.3 | 22.9 | 77 |
| July | 19.6 | 16.6 | 8 | 43 | 70 | 10.5 | 21.9 | 85 |
| August | 20.1 | 16.8 | 6 | 52 | 69 | 11.1 | 21.5 | 88 |
| September | 21.5 | 18.5 | 7 | 37 | 72 | 11.9 | 21.9 | 87 |
| October | 22.7 | 19.9 | 11 | 85 | 74 | 12.7 | 22.8 | 80 |
| November | 24.1 | 21.5 | 11 | 94 | 75 | 13.5 | 24 | 78 |
| December | 25.5 | 23 | 14 | 134 | 76 | 13.9 | 25.3 | 72 |
